It's a remote backup service. While there are certainly benefits to having a remote backup, there are certainly downsides to not having full control over what may be vital company information. They do encrypt everything and use SSL, so at least security seems to have been well considered.
[link|http://www.ibackup.com/|iBackup].
No experience with it myself, just passing on a pointer.
Cheers,
Scott.